The relative density (specific gravity) of an aggregate is the ratio of its mass to the mass of an equal volume of water. Relative Density = Mass of the Aggregate / Mass of equal volume of water. Key Features: Most aggregates have a relative density between 2.4-2.9 with a corresponding particle (mass) density of 2400-2900 kg/m3 (150-181 lb/ft3).

Crushed scoria is defined as being ejected pyroclastic rock in origin and vesicular (honey combed) in nature. The crushed scoria shall be derived by crushing clean spalls and shall consist of hard, durable particles free from clay. The particle density shall be in excess of 2.4 t/m3.
